    What are the different kinds of primary care providers, including Pediatricians,  near Richfield Springs, NY?

    • A pediatrician is an expert in childhood growth and development and they are frequently the primary care provider for children under 18.
    • Adults near Richfield Springs, NY generally see an Internist, a General Practitioner, or a Family Practitioner (often informally called a Family Doctor) for their primary care.
    • Older adults near Richfield Springs, NY may see a Geriatrician, which is a provider that specializes in the care of older people.
    • Some women near Richfield Springs, NY choose to receive their primary care from their OB/GYN (obstetrician/gynecologist), though if you have multiple medical issues, it may be in your best interest to find a primary care physician.

    What should I bring with me to an appointment with my Pediatrician near Richfield Springs, NY?

    Bring your list of concerns (or reasons for your visit) with you on a piece of paper or your phone, so you can easily recall them when speaking to your Pediatrician in Richfield Springs. You may want to consider bringing a friend or loved one for support, and to help you recall the information after your Pediatrician visit. Bring a notebook so you can take notes, copies of your medical records (dating back at least one year), a list of current medications, supplements and allergies to medications, your family history of disease, and a list of symptoms (and details about how long they last and how often they occur) to discuss with your Richfield Springs Pediatrician.
